At it Again Roy has a new paper called the Roy end Solai.o Herald, but it does not say who its editor might be. Report says A. S. Bushke vitz is behind the new enterprise. Roy finds another newspaper about as' n;cessary as a thirty story hotel. The outfit is said to have been used in Sprir.ger at one time. Springer Stockman. You are correct. Roy has a nother paper but it is not printed with the out-lit that was used in Springer. The same outfit is here but it is tied ,up so it cannot beJ used. The dope sheet is printed in Denver, and consists mostly of Hot Air, of which the editor has plenty. Our hustling little neighbor, Roy, is at it again, and this time it looks like a tight to a hnisn un der no special rules. An election for v;llage officials was to have been held there Tuesday, some people contending that it would be illegal, while others had plac ed a ticket in the field. Anyway an injunction stopped the whole proceedings, so now a bitter feel .ing prevails. It has' long" been hoped that Roy would stop her foolishness,' she is old enough to know better, and it is the general beiief that she is getting in a po sition to do so, and has gotten on the right track, which will lead to á better-Roy with a more pros perous and more contented people.-' Springer Stockman. Yes brother Hutchinson it is true that the Taxpayers and Lead ing citizens of the town stopped the election. It was not a tight against the incorporation of the town, but aright agflinst the big Bloat that wanted to be our May or,' the man who says he has a clean record, but he cannot prove it. Roy is indeed on the right track to make a cleaning and a cleaning it will sure be. The matter of cari'ying guns should be taken before the text grand jury. It is an insult to the community to have armed men with pistols on the street in what is supposed to be a civilized, town. How long will this continue? Who is responsible for this? Roy and Solano Herald. We certainly believe that the carrying of guns should by all means be stopped in the new state of New Mexico, and the first one to start on should oe the editor of the common paper, better known as the Roy and Solano Herald, wlo does not walk on the street with out a six-shooter or an arm ed body guard.
